Abstract

The utility model discloses a brake shoe pressure static detection device, which comprises a notebook computer, a PLC, an AD041 analog quantity acquisition module, a wireless transmission module, a 24V power supply and a brake shoe pressure sensor; the static brake shoe pressure detection device provided by the utility model can collect the brake shoe pressure of the truck; the sensor is placed in a gap between a brake shoe and a wheel of a vehicle, various parameters of the truck are input on a notebook computer program, and the PLC controls the AD041 analog quantity acquisition module to acquire the data of the sensor according to a set program; the test result is uploaded to a notebook computer program interface through the wireless transmission module, and the brake shoe pressure test detection work is completed.

Brake shoe pressure static detection device
Technical Field
The utility model relates to a static detection device of brake shoe pressure for railway vehicle's brake shoe pressure is gathered, is saved, and the requirement, test method and the inspection rule of the vehicle brake shoe force test of regulation in "about railway freight car static brake shoe pressure experiment technical condition" are designed according to the ministry of transportation of the people's republic of China railway.
Background
Along with the development of society, the safety degree of railway transportation is far higher than that of air transportation and road transportation, and the railway transportation becomes the first-choice vehicle for most people to go on long journey, the detection and maintenance of vehicles become the central importance of safety guarantee work, and the detection of braking system is the first process of vehicle detection, whether normal work of braking system directly relates to whether the vehicle can run safely, the detection of the prior railway vehicle braking system is the detection of artificial striking, because the vehicle volume is larger, the detection is very complicated and fussy, a lot of inconvenience is brought to workers, and the safe running of the vehicle can not be guaranteed due to the reason of artificial detection.
SUMMERY OF THE UTILITY MODEL
In order to overcome the defects, the utility model provides a static detection device for brake shoe pressure, which adopts a distributed test scheme of an upper computer and a lower computer, wherein the lower computer is responsible for the data acquisition of a pressure sensor and is in wireless connection with the upper computer through a 485 communication module and a wireless module, so as to realize the data communication of control and acquisition; the host computer is 1 notebook computer, be responsible for carrying out the communication and the control testing process of pressure detection data with the next computer, manage and print the detection data, fully realize the convenience of test system use and the centralization of data, the sensor that test system adopted is high accuracy, it is ultra-thin, the authenticity, the accuracy of brake shoe pressure have fundamentally been guaranteed to the design scheme that two points gathered simultaneously in the test process, only need in the test process put the brake shoe of vehicle and wheel gap with the sensor can, easy operation is convenient, practice thrift manpower and materials, easy maintenance.
In order to achieve the above object, the present invention provides the following technical solutions:
a static brake shoe pressure detection device is characterized in that the whole machine consists of a notebook computer (7), a PLC (1), an AD041 analog quantity acquisition module (2), a wireless transmission module (3), a 24V power supply (4) and a brake shoe pressure sensor (6); the 24V power supply (4) converts an external 220V voltage into a 24V voltage to supply power to the sensor; the brake shoe pressure sensor (6) is placed in a gap between a brake shoe and a wheel of a vehicle to collect pressure; the AD041 analog quantity acquisition module (2) acquires the numerical value of each brake shoe pressure sensor (6); the PLC (1) is connected with the AD041 analog quantity acquisition module (2) and is used for controlling the acquisition of sensor data; the wireless transmission module (3) is a management center for data transmission and reports the acquired data to a program of a notebook computer (7); the notebook computer (7) can store, inquire and print test data.

Detailed Description
Please refer to fig. 1 and 2: the whole machine consists of a notebook computer (7), a PLC (1), an AD041 analog quantity acquisition module (2), a wireless transmission module (3), a 24V power supply (4) and a brake shoe pressure sensor (6); the PLC (1) is connected with the AD041 analog quantity acquisition module (2) to realize the acquisition of the pressure between the brake shoes; the 24V power supply (4) mainly converts an external 220V voltage into a 24V voltage to supply power to the sensor; the wireless transmission module (3) is a management center for data transmission, realizes control and collected data communication, and reports the collected data to a program of the notebook computer (7); the notebook computer (7) is a data management and storage center and is responsible for communicating pressure detection data with a lower computer, controlling a test process and managing and printing the detection data; the brake shoe pressure sensor (6) is responsible for testing the pressure between brake shoes, the brake shoe pressure sensor (6) is placed in a gap between a brake shoe and a wheel of a vehicle to collect and test the pressure between the brake shoes, various parameters are input on a program interface of a notebook computer (7), the operation is started, the brake shoe pressure sensor (6) converts pressure into pressure value data through an AD041 analog quantity collection module (2) after collecting the pressure and transmits the pressure value data to a PLC (1), and after a test to be tested is completed, a test result is uploaded and displayed on the program interface of the notebook computer (7) through a wireless transmission module (3).
